Interview potential home builders to get the response to all the inquiries you have. Right here is a checklist of questions to ask builders. Then, check out a contractor's lately constructed homes and neighborhoods. Drive by on a Saturday morning when resident might be outdoors doing jobs or duties. Present on your own and state you are thinking about purchasing a home from the builder that constructed their home.


Some questions to ask home proprietors include: Are you happy with your home? Would you acquire an additional home from this home builder?


At the extremely the very least, drive by and see if the homes are visually appealing. When you speak to contractors and resident, bring a notebook to videotape the details you discover and your individual perceptions about specific building contractors and homes. Doing so will certainly assist you to make comparisons later on.

Home programs and open homes sponsored by builders are great opportunities to look at homes. Design homes and houses displayed in home shows are frequently provided to give you ideas for using the area.


Ask the contractor or the contractor's agent a great deal of inquiries. Obtain as numerous specifics as feasible.

When collaborating with a basic service provider, you may not recognize exactly how typically you'll be updated on the standing of the project - Will you obtain updates weekly, monthly, or daily, and from the contract or the sub-contractors? General specialists can absolutely offer exceptional interaction, however including subcontractors can make things more difficult.


A custom-made home building contractor will certainly also have the ability to more conveniently simplify the project, having collaborated with a seasoned team for years and counting on trusted tradespeople for sub tasks. A basic specialist may have the best of of objectives, yet contracting out the job opens the door for miscommunications and hold-ups, a lot to everybody's consternation.
